ed �?Coating selections: AR, BBAR or P-coating Lithium Iodate (LilO3) Crystal is usually a uniaxial nonlinear crystal with superior nonlinear coefficients and a broad optical clear range of 0.fiveμm to five.0μm. It is extensively applied for the SHG from the reduced and medium electrical power Ti:Sapphire, Alexandrite, Cr:LiSrAlF6 and Cr:LiCaAlF6 lasers. It's also preferable for your SHG and THG of Nd:YAG lasers and auto-correlators for measuring extremely-short pulse width. Its hexagonal structure and outstanding optical homogeneity help it become perfect for important laser factors. However, LiIO3 is highly hygroscopic and needs dry storage and sealed housing for extended sturdiness.
